The campus was buzzing with energy, excitement, and new beginnings as the Fall 2026 New Student Welcome Week started. SUNY Korea welcomed 231 new students to campus for Fall 2026 New Student Welcome Week, a multi-day program designed to help incoming students prepare for university life, connect with the SUNY Korea community, and begin their academic journey.
The journey began with Placement Exam Day, where students completed required placement examinations in writing and mathematics.
During Activities Day, new students participated in ice-breaking activities, campus tours, special workshops, and activities with Resident Assistants (RAs). The program provided students with opportunities to meet their peers, explore the campus, and begin building connections within the SUNY Korea community.
University Day introduced students to key aspects of academic and campus life. Sessions included introductions to university academic policies and procedures, academic integrity, departmental gatherings, and workshops designed to help students prepare for their transition to university.
The program continued with Course Registration Day, during which students received guidance and completed their course registration for the Fall 2026 semester. Students also had the opportunioty to meet their department chairs and faculty.
The week concluded with Convocation Day, marking the official welcome of the new students to the SUNY Korea community.
The New Student Welcome Week equips the new students with a foundation for a successful transition into university life while creating opportunities to connect with classmates, faculty, staff, and the broader campus community.
Welcome to SUNY Korea, and welcome home.
